Police solve Capri Gold Loan bank loot case of Gadarwara

Monday, 20 March 2023 | Staff Reporter | BHOPAL

Five persons are arrested in Capri Gold Loan Bank, Gadarwara, in district Narsinghpur of Madhya Pradesh on Saturday.

Abhishek Dagar alias Shekhu (26) resident of Gururgram, Haryana and Vikrant Mehra alias Jeeva (28) resident of Charki Dadri, Haryana, Rohit Rathi (25) resident Delhi, Ramjeet Jat (23) resident of Mathura, Uttar Pradesh and Arjun Sharma (20) resident of Mathura, Uttar Pradesh were arrested, the police said.

Three accused have criminal background including Abhishek and Vikratn against whom case is registered with the police in Haryana while criminal case is registered against Ramjeet in Uttar Pradesh.

On February 8, 2023 around 2.45 pm at Capri Gold Loan Bank branch at Gadarwara in district Narsinghpur, Madhya Pradesh Rs 3,52,000 were looted on gun point.

After the incident the accused fled in a white color car, the police said.

Capri Gold Loan Bank senior loan officer Sachin Jain made a complaint to the Gadarwara police station about the loot and the case was registered under section 392, 34 of IPC.

The CCTV footage of the road routes, toll plazas, petrol pumps the location of the car was traced and teams of cops was formed.

The teams of cops went to New Delhi, Gurugram (Haryana), Mathura and (Uttar Pradesh) in search of the accused persons but the accused persons were continuously changing their place, the police said.

The last location of the car was found in Gaurjhamar – Deori area where the team of cop intercepted the car and arrested the accused persons.

The police seized from accused, one pistol, two countrymade revolver, 38 round, Rs 1.80 lakh and on interrogation they revealed of entered the bank and looted the amount on gun point, the police said.
